2. Unique and Custom Designs
Independent jewelers often offer a wider selection of unique and custom-designed rings compared to large retailers. Many chain stores focus on mass-produced pieces that are created to appeal to a broad audience, which can lead to more generic options. In contrast, independent jewelers take pride in offering pieces that are one-of-a-kind or hand-crafted with unique materials and designs.
If you’re looking for something that reflects your personality, taste, or the special meaning behind the occasion, an independent jeweler can work with you to design a custom piece that is truly unique. From choosing the perfect gemstone to selecting the metal type and band design, you can collaborate with the jeweler to create a ring that speaks to your individuality and taste. This custom experience adds an extra layer of sentimentality to the piece, making it even more meaningful.

4. Quality Materials
Independent jewelers are often more selective when it comes to the materials they use in their pieces. Unlike larger chain stores, which may be focused on mass production and cost-cutting, independent jewelers typically prioritize quality over quantity. Many independent jewelers work with ethical and sustainable sources for their gemstones and metals, ensuring that the materials used in your ring are of the highest quality.
Whether you’re looking for conflict-free diamonds, rare gemstones, or eco-friendly metals, an independent jeweler can offer you a range of choices that align with your values and preferences. You’ll have the opportunity to learn about the origins of the materials used in your ring and make an informed decision about the ethical implications of your purchase.
5. Competitive Pricing and Transparent Pricing
While independent jewelers might not have the same extensive advertising budgets as chain stores, they often offer competitive pricing on their rings. Many independent jewelers operate with lower overhead costs, which allows them to pass the savings on to their customers. You may find that an independent jeweler offers a more affordable option for high-quality pieces compared to larger retailers.
Moreover, independent jewelers are often more transparent about pricing. They take the time to explain the cost breakdown, including the value of the gemstone, metal, and craftsmanship. This level of transparency allows you to understand exactly what you are paying for and ensures there are no hidden fees or inflated prices.
